CNA EXAM FOR BOARDS QUESTIONS
AND ANSWERS.
When taking an oral temperature, it is important to.... -
\place therometer under the tounge
For safety, when leaving a client alone in a room, the nurse aide SHOULD -
\place signaling light within the person's reach
To convert four ounces of juice to milliliters (ml), the nurse aide should multiply -
\4x30 ml
Why do residents with Parkinson's disease require assistance when walking? -
\They have a shuffling gait and often tremors
an Apical plus is counted for how long -
\1 minute
A Foley catheter is used for: -
\to drain fluids from the bladder.
A diabetic resident asks the nurse aide to cut her toenails. The nurse aide should -
\tell the resident that a nursing aide is not allowed to do that, yet they will report it.
Which conditions promotes the growth of bacteria? -
\dark, warm, moist
You observe a co-worker verbally abusing a resident, what should you do? -
\report it to the charge nurse
When documenting in a patient's record, which statement is FALSE? -
\"to save time, chart the procedure before doing the task
While giving a bedbath, the nurse aide hears the alarm from a nearby door suddenly go
off. The nurse aide should ___________. -
\pause the bath, make sure resident is safe, and go check on the alarm
Why should heat not be applied to a diabetic resident's feet/ -
\diabetics have a decreased sensitivity to heat
Mrs. Johnson, a resident with dementia, loves to wear her favorite blue plaid shirt with
her favorite green striped pants. What should you do? -
\respect her choice in clothing
,A nurse aide who is active in her church is assigned to care for a client who is not a
member of any religious group. The nurse aide SHOULD: -
\respect the residents beliefs
The most comfortable position for a resident with a respiratory problem is -
\Fowlers
The nurse aide finds a resident sobbing. What is the best thing for the nurse aide to
say? -
\'You seem sad. Do you want to talk about it?"
The nurse aide finds a conscious client lying on the bathroom floor. The FIRST thing the
nurse aide should do is -
\call for help and stay with the client or resident
What are the main components for successful communication? -
\a sender, a message, a receiver
A patient complains of feeling short of breath and nauseated. Her face is rapidly turning
red. She tells the nurse aide that she didn't know there were strawberries in the gelatin
she ate. The aide should -
\notify the nurse immediately
How many tips does a quad-cane base have? -
\4
A terminally ill resident, John Castillo, visits with his family. He discusses his funeral
arrangements with them. He lets them know that he is concerned about their well-being
after he is gone. He says he wants to spend as much time as possible with them before
he dies. Mr. Castillo is going through the ________ stage of grief. -
\Acceptance
When dry, hard stool fills the rectum and will not pass, it is called -
\Impaction
You can assist clients with their spiritual needs by -
\Encouraging them to talk about their beliefs
Which of the following foods is allowed in a clear liquid diet? -
\Jello
